Analysis: Protesters try last hurrah

By Marie Horrigan
UPI Deputy Americas Editor

-snip-

Massachusetts native Sheila Parks has set up vigils in front of Sen. John Kerry's residence in Boston, which she said are attended by 10 to 15 people each day. Parks also is part of a delegation that is scheduled to travel to Washington Tuesday to make its case personally to a "dream team" of senators they think might be willing to hold up the vote certification.

Her group, Coalition Against Election Fraud, also is scheduled to meet Wednesday with representatives from Kerry's Senate office, who they will give copies of online petitions, letters and postcards from supporters and citizens asking Kerry not to certify the vote.

-snip-

A spokesman for Sen. Barbara Boxer, D-Calif., meanwhile, said the office had received a number of petitions Monday but would not comment on how Boxer intended to vote on the certification.

Parks said she couldn't imagine why no Democratic senator had stepped forward. "Maybe it's what we always said, that once they get in there they lose their integrity," she said.

But if no one does so, she added, she was going to start voting Green.
